# Copyright 1999-2008 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 # $Header: $ EAPI=1 JAVA_PKG_IUSE="" inherit eutils java-pkg-2 java-ant-2 multilib MY_P="${P/jabref/JabRef}" DESCRIPTION="JabRef plugin for inserting citations into OpenOffice." HOMEPAGE="http://www.itk.ntnu.no/ansatte/Alver_Omholt_Morten/jabref/OOPlugin.html" SRC_URI="http://www.itk.ntnu.no/ansatte/Alver_Omholt_Morten/jabref/${MY_P}-src.zip" LICENSE="GPL-2" SLOT="0" KEYWORDS="~x86 ~sparc ~ppc ~amd64 ~ppc64" IUSE="doc" COMMON_DEP=" >=app-text/jabref-2.4.2 >=app-office/openoffice-3.0.0 >=dev-java/jgoodies-forms-1.1.0 >=dev-java/glazedlists-1.7.0" RDEPEND=">=virtual/jre-1.5 ${COMMON_DEP}" DEPEND=">=virtual/jdk-1.5 ${COMMON_DEP}" S=${WORKDIR}/jabref-oo-0.1-src RESTRICT="mirror" EANT_DOC_TARGET="" src_unpack() { unpack ${A} cd "${S}" mkdir -p dist/plugins || die einfo "Patching build.xml" sed -ire \ 's/name="JabRef-.*\.jar"/name="*.jar"/' \ build.xml || die cd lib rm -v *.jar || die java-pkg_jar-from jabref java-pkg_jar-from openoffice java-pkg_jar-from jgoodies-forms java-pkg_jar-from glazedlists ln -s /usr/$(get_libdir)/openoffice/ure/share/java/*.jar . } src_install() { java-pkg_jarinto /usr/share/jabref/lib/plugins/ java-pkg_newjar dist/plugins/net.sf.jabref.oo.ooplugin-0.1.jar \ net.sf.jabref.oo.ooplugin.jar use doc && dohtml OOPlugin.html use doc && dodoc CHANGELOG example_style_file.jstyle }